ABOUT US
At HomeServe USA, our mission is simple: To free our customers from the worry and inconvenience of home emergency repairs. And since 2003 we’ve been doing just that. We provide homeowners across the country with affordable home emergency repair plans that offer protection from the high cost of repair bills and provide help for home emergency repairs, all with just one phone call.

Response time was very good but service was not. Plumber was advised the clean out was in the garage and insisted on going through the kitchen sink access. About four hours later he advised he had heard it clear. He was loading his truck when I went in the garage and saw the disaster. He broke the pipes in the two joints - flooding the furnace room, ceiling area and 3/4 of the Garage with grey water. A plugged sink drain is over $10,000.00 in repairs !He looked and said, "Oh, your pipes must be bad and left saying someone would call." I'm sure the four hours of powered snake activity contributed greatly. I called our regular plumber and never heard from the Homeserve folks until we called them the following day. Two weeks later I'm still dealing with the damage !!
